Output 84ba3b71b708de316efe1c501190926cd62284643f5cc30f6cb5e445dd7ce6e2:1

value
21671935
script pubkey
OP_0 OP_PUSHBYTES_32 3eb93e88b963891cdc81a0997d501457a2e4d3629e9e9b21c8669f0d38e8d3b7
address
bc1q86unaz9evwy3ehyp5zvh65q5273wf5mzn60fkgwgv60s6w8g6wmsj483u4
transaction
84ba3b71b708de316efe1c501190926cd62284643f5cc30f6cb5e445dd7ce6e2
spent
true